20 Seeds| Pepper Seeds – Sweet – Big Red

To germinate and grow Sweet Big Red Pepper Seeds successfully, follow these steps: Timing: Peppers are warm-season crops that require a long growing season. Start pepper seeds indoors 8-10 weeks before the last expected frost date in your area. Transplant seedlings outdoors once all danger of frost has passed and the soil has warmed up. Germination Medium: Use a well-draining seed starting mix or potting soil for germinating pepper seeds. Avoid using heavy garden soil, as it can lead to poor drainage and seed rot. Planting Seeds: Plant pepper seeds ¼ inch deep in small pots or seed trays filled with the germination medium. Place 2-3 seeds per pot to ensure germination success. If planting multiple seeds per pot, thin the seedlings to one per pot once they have germinated and developed their first true leaves. Moisture and Temperature: Keep the germination medium consistently moist but not waterlogged. Pepper seeds germinate best in warm soil with temperatures between 70°F to 90°F (21°C to 32°C). Consider using a seedling heat mat to provide consistent warmth, especially if your indoor environment is cooler. Lighting: Pepper seeds do not require light for germination, but once they sprout, they need plenty of light to grow healthy. Place the seed trays or pots in a bright location, such as a sunny windowsill or under grow lights. Germination Time: Pepper seeds typically germinate within 7 to 14 days under optimal conditions. Be patient and keep the germination medium consistently moist during this period. Transplanting: When the pepper seedlings have at least two sets of true leaves and all risk of frost has passed, they can be transplanted into the garden. Harden off the seedlings by gradually exposing them to outdoor conditions over the course of 7 to 10 days before transplanting. Outdoor Planting: Choose a sunny location in the garden with well-draining soil. Space the pepper seedlings 18-24 inches apart in rows spaced 24-36 inches apart, depending on the size of the mature plants. Care: Keep the soil consistently moist throughout the growing season, especially during dry periods. Mulch around the base of the plants to help retain soil moisture, regulate soil temperature, and suppress weeds. Fertilize the pepper plants with a balanced fertilizer or side dress with compost during the growing season to promote healthy growth and fruit production.

Seed Packs(Specially SelectedVarieties) Grow your winter garden in the Sunshine StatefromFebruary (Last Frost depending on location in Florida) through May. The spring growing season is the time of year to finish the last bit of the Winter harvest (mainly leafy herbs and veggies) & begin the process of planting fruiting plants. The Spring season begins with the occurrence of theLAST FROST. This can be as late as April 15th in North Florida or as early as January in South Florida. Central Florida tends have their last frost around early to mid March. Mother Nature can be unpredictable though, so each year is always unique. Spring is the Opportunity to grow the largest diversity of edible plants in the Florida Garden. Everything from leafy veggies, to mainly fruiting plants will populate the garden. How long does Floridas Spring Growing Season last? The Spring growing Season is sandwiched between the coldest temperatures of the Florida Winter (which may or may not be freezing temperatures) and the ever-increasing Summer Heat. On Average:the Spring Growing runs February (Last Frost depending on location in Florida) through May. More Specifically:North Florida is normally the end of March through June. Central Florida March through May. South Florida December or January through April or May.

Untitled DocumentStoreFeedbackFollow UsSouthern Giant Curled Mustardis an award winning and fast growing plant with heavy yields that is also resistant to bolting. It is recommended to grow them at the mildest time of year for your climate, or in the spring and fall for hotter climates and the summer for colder climates. These up-right growing leaves are large and bountiful with a pungent earthy and peppery flavor. Southern Giant Mustard is great added to soups or stews, sauteed alongside other greens, fresh in a salad, or even frozen or pickled for use during the winter months. You can harvest these greens at their young baby stages or allow them to reach up to 5 inches in height to harvest at full maturity. You can also use this seed to grow microgreens! Untitled DocumentStoreFeedbackFollow UsSlow Bolt Arugulais one of the fastest growing seeds we sell, maturing in only 40 to 45 days. These seeds are ideal for farmers & gardeners living in areas with very warm summers since they are slower to bolt and are far more tolerant to heat than other cultivars. Slow Bolt Arugula seeds helps to maintain the best possible flavor while in the garden, since they are slow to bolt and produce seed which immediately spoils flavor, color, and tenderness. This seed also thrives in pots, planters, or as an indoor hydroponic crop as well. These Arugula seeds quickly mature into tender annual greens that are best when harvested at about 2 to 3 inches tall but can continue to be harvest as it grows up to 5 to 6 inches tall. The entire plant may be harvested, or individual leaves may be cut from the plant. The leaves have are high in vitamins A and C as well as being a good source of iron. Harvest the white flowers with dark veins as they appear. Arugula leaves give a sharp, spicy, peppery taste, similar to a mild horseradish but with a green & earthy twist. It makes a delicious side salad with a simple vinaigrette dressing, or can be used on sandwiches and burgers for a peppery substitute to lettuce.
